Performance Assessment Specialist IV Salary in South Dakota

How much does Performance Assessment Specialist IV make in South Dakota?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for Performance Assessment Specialist IV in South Dakota is $105,770 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$51.

However, Performance Assessment Specialist IV's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$122,181
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$96,580 to $114,360
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$88,213

Performance Assessment Specialist IV Salary by Company Size: Startups vs. Enterprise

Performance Assessment Specialist IV salary potential scales significantly with company size. Data shows that Enterprise companies (5,000+ employees) pay the highest average salary at around $118,403. While startup companies pay approximate $100,166.

Performance Assessment Specialist IV Salary by Company Size

Company Size Employees Average Salary
Startup1~50$100,166
Growth Stage51~500$105,938
Established501~5000$114,339
Enterprise5000+$118,403

Performance Assessment Specialist IV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Performance Assessment Specialist IV ro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 90%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Biotechnology and Software & Networking s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 40% above the average. In contrast, Performance Assessment Specialist positions in Edu., Gov't. & Nonprofit or Hospitality & Leisure typ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Performance Assessment Specialist IV as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.

The top paying industries for Performance Assessment Specialist IV

Industry Sector Average Annual Salary Average Hourly Rate Pay vs.Avg
Biotechnology$148,078$71.040%
Software & Networking$148,078$71.040%
Pharmaceuticals$142,790$69.035%
Financial Services$137,501$66.030%
Internet$132,212$64.025%
